Table F.4.

Changes in the piece-wise constant social interaction parameter ρ(t) of the model for Austria.

ρn Starting Date Measure or change in social activities Manual Calibration Which Wave
ρ0 No restrictions 1
ρ1 16.03 Closure schools/universities, limitations in shops/restaurants 0.52 1st
ρ2 30.03 Wearing masks 0.155 1st
ρ3 14.04 Opening small shops 0.22 1st
ρ4 01.05 Opening malls and hairdressers 0.27 1st
ρ5 15.05 Opening certain school classes 0.31 1st
ρ6 29.05 Opening additional schools 0.33 2nd
ρ7 15.06 Mask obligation in public area, no mask in shops/schools 0.38 2nd
ρ8 11.07 School holidays 0.36 2nd
ρ9 21.07 Mask obligation everywhere 0.32 2nd
ρ10 13.08 Increase of infections due to people returning from holidays 0.385 2nd
ρ11 14.09 Opening schools 0.415 2nd
ρ12 21.09 Extended mask obligation/ 10 people invitations 0.405 2nd
ρ13 25.09 Curfew (10 p.m.) Salzburg, Voralberg and Tirol 0.395 2nd
ρ14 23.10 Private gatherings limited to 6 people inside, 12 outside 0.385 2nd
ρ15 03.11 Lockdown 0.27 2nd
ρ16 07.12 Relief of lockdown 0.34 2nd
